#0e953d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0e953d is composed of 5.5% red, 58.4%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.1%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 140.9 degrees, a saturation of 82.8% and a lightness of 32%. #0e953d color hex could be obtained by blending #1cff7a with #002b00.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

Shades and Tints of #0e953d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010602 is the darkest color, while #f3fef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#0e953d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d5650 is the less saturated color, while #01a239 is the most saturated one.
